Physical Attributes and Material Science


The clips feature a transparent plastic construction, a deliberate design choice that allows for unobtrusive integration into any decor. This material choice also permits visual inspection of the secured cable, a critical aspect for identifying potential insulation degradation or conductor stress without removing the clip. Dimensions are precisely engineered: a length of 33mm (1.3 inches) and a width of 13mm (0.512 inches). These dimensions provide sufficient surface area for the adhesive backing while maintaining a compact profile. The internal channel is approximately 5mm (0.197 inches) in diameter. This size is ideal for standard USB cables, Ethernet cables, and light-gauge power cords. Small clips, big impact.

The material's clarity is not merely aesthetic; it serves a functional purpose. It allows for quick visual checks of the cable's outer jacket. Unlike opaque cable management solutions, these clips do not obscure the cable, enabling an electrician or user to readily spot nicks, cuts, or signs of overheating on the insulation. This transparency is a subtle yet significant advantage for routine safety inspections, allowing for proactive identification of potential electrical faults before they escalate. The plastic itself appears to be a durable, non-conductive polymer, essential for any component interacting with electrical wiring. Its inherent insulating properties prevent accidental short circuits if a cable's outer jacket were to be compromised, adding an extra layer of protection.

Ensuring Electrical Pathway Integrity


Proper cable management is paramount for electrical safety. Loose cables present multiple risks, including tripping hazards, accidental disconnections, and, most critically, physical damage to the cable's insulation. These clips actively prevent such damage by securing cables firmly against a surface. This reduces the likelihood of cables being pinched, abraded, or subjected to excessive strain from foot traffic or furniture movement. Maintaining the integrity of a cable's insulation is non-negotiable for any electrical installation. Compromised insulation can expose live conductors, leading to electrical shock, arc faults, or even fire. These clips are a first line of defense.

The secure hold provided by these clips minimizes cable movement. Reduced movement means less wear and tear on the cable jacket, which is the primary protective barrier for the internal conductors. This directly extends the operational lifespan of the conductors and the devices they power. Furthermore, by keeping cables organized and separated, these clips facilitate better airflow around power-carrying wires. Clustered cables can impede heat dissipation, leading to localized overheating, which accelerates insulation degradation, reduces the cable's current carrying capacity, and significantly increases fire risk. A clear pathway is a safer pathway, ensuring optimal thermal management.

Adhesive Adherence and Surface Compatibility


The efficacy of these cable clips relies heavily on their adhesive backing. The images indicate a strong, peel-and-stick adhesive designed for straightforward application. Proper surface preparation is critical for maximizing the adhesive bond. Surfaces must be meticulously cleaned, thoroughly dried, and smooth to ensure optimal contact between the adhesive and the substrate. Dust, grease, moisture, or uneven textures will significantly reduce adhesion strength, leading to premature detachment and compromised cable security. The adhesive appears to be a pressure-sensitive type, requiring firm, sustained application pressure for at least 30 seconds to achieve its full bonding potential. This ensures a lasting grip.

The adhesive layer is engineered for robust, yet not necessarily permanent, attachment. This allows for a degree of flexibility in installation and potential repositioning, though repeated removal and reapplication will diminish its effectiveness. However, users must understand the implications for surface integrity. While highly effective on durable surfaces like painted walls, finished wooden desks, metal, or smooth plastic, removal can potentially damage delicate surfaces such as wallpaper, poorly bonded paint, or certain types of plaster. This is a trade-off for strong adhesion, and a test on an inconspicuous area is always recommended before widespread application to avoid costly repairs. Surface integrity matters.

Compared to screw-in or nail-in cable clamps, adhesive clips offer a non-invasive installation method. This preserves the structural integrity of walls and furniture, avoiding holes or punctures. They are ideal for rental properties, temporary setups, or situations where drilling is undesirable or impractical. The convenience of installation is a major benefit, reducing labor and tool requirements. However, their load-bearing capacity is inherently lower than mechanical fasteners, making them unsuitable for heavy-gauge electrical conduits or large, weighty cable bundles. This is a key distinction for electrical professionals when selecting appropriate cable management solutions.

Long-Term System Reliability and Maintenance Efficiency


The consistent application of these cable clips contributes significantly to the long-term reliability and overall maintenance efficiency of electrical systems. By protecting cables from physical stress, abrasion against sharp edges, and entanglement, they extend the operational life of expensive electronic equipment and their associated wiring infrastructure. Cables that are properly supported and routed are less likely to experience internal conductor fatigue, insulation breakdown, or connector strain, which are common causes of intermittent connectivity, signal loss, or complete electrical failure. This proactive protection saves money and reduces downtime.

Consider the cumulative effect of minor stresses on a power cord or data cable. Repeated bending, pulling, crushing under furniture, or constant friction can lead to micro-fractures in the conductors or degradation of the dielectric insulation. Over time, these micro-fractures can propagate, leading to increased electrical resistance, localized heat generation, and eventually, a catastrophic failure of the cable. These clips prevent such cumulative damage by holding the cable securely in place, maintaining its intended geometry and minimizing external forces. They ensure consistent performance over time.

Unlike temporary fixes or haphazard bundling, these clips provide a stable, enduring solution for cable management. They are designed for sustained use in a variety of indoor environments. This contrasts sharply with adhesive tapes that can lose tackiness, or zip ties that can be overtightened, potentially damaging insulation.
